3. While preparing to write, what do
authors do?
• 1. They make lists or outlines.
• 2. They sketch.
4. What do authors do when they
receive a rejection letter from the
publisher?
• The rewrite their manuscripts and.
• They send out to other publishers.
5. What is the final step in the
writing process?
• Get the manuscript published.
6. What do authors do when they
interview people?
• They take notes.
7. How do authors get more
information for their books?
• 1. They go to libraries, historical societies,
museums..
• 2. They read books, old newspapers, magazines,
letters and diaries written long ago. They take
notes.
• 3. They interview people and take more notes.
• 4. They listen and watch.
8. Why do authors show their work
to other people?
• To get suggestions. See if people like their
work.
